#ca7154 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ca7154 is composed of 79.2% red, 44.3%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.1% magenta, 58.4%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 14.7 degrees, a saturation of 52.7% and a lightness of 56.1%. #ca7154 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e2a8 with #950000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#ca7154 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ca7154 has RGB values of R:202, G:113,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.44, Y:0.58,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 13267284.

Shades and Tints of #ca7154
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090403 is the darkest color, while #fdfaf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ca7154
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#968b88 is the less saturated color, while #fe5720 is the most saturated one.
